The Science: What Changes in Your Eyes After 35
Your eyes are complex optical systems. Light enters through the cornea and lens, which focus that light onto the retina at the back of your eye. The retina converts light into electrical signals that travel via the optic nerve to your brain, where images are processed and perceived. Age affects multiple parts of this system.
Presbyopia is the most obvious change. The lens in your eye is made of proteins that gradually become less flexible with age. When you’re young, your lens changes shape easily, allowing you to focus on objects at any distance. After 35, this flexibility gradually declines. By 40, most people notice they can’t focus on close objects as easily. By 45, most people need reading glasses. This isn’t pathological; it’s normal aging. But the rate of progression depends on your eye health habits.
The lens also becomes less transparent with age. Proteins in the lens can clump and become opaque, a process called cataract formation. Cataracts typically don’t cause symptoms until they’re advanced, but the process begins years earlier. Spending excessive time in bright sun without UV protection accelerates this significantly.
The cornea and lens become less able to manage glare. This is why night driving becomes more challenging. Glare from oncoming headlights, streetlights, and reflections becomes more bothersome. This isn’t just an inconvenience; it’s a safety issue.
Your retina also ages. The macula, the central part of the retina responsible for sharp central vision, gradually changes with age. Age-related macular degeneration (AMD) is rare before age 50 but becomes increasingly common in the 50s and 60s. However, the foundation for AMD is often laid decades earlier through oxidative stress and inflammation.
Additionally, your eye muscles weaken with age. These muscles control eye movement and accommodation (focusing). Weakness contributes to eye strain and difficulty with sustained near vision work.
Dry eye becomes more common after 35. Tear production naturally declines with age, and hormonal changes (particularly in women) worsen this. Dry eyes create discomfort and can impair vision.
Why Your 35–45 Age Group Is the Eye Health Inflection Point
This is the decade when age-related eye changes become visually noticeable, but you’re still young enough to significantly influence long-term outcomes. A 35-year-old rarely thinks about their eyesight. A 45-year-old is noticing presbyopia and possibly beginning to worry about macular degeneration or cataracts. A 55-year-old might be managing significant vision changes.
Additionally, screen time has exploded during your 40s. Most adults now spend 8–10 hours per day looking at screens—computers, tablets, phones. This extended near-vision work accelerates several problems. Focusing on screens for hours strains the ciliary muscles (eye muscles controlling focus), exacerbating presbyopia. Blue light from screens contributes to oxidative stress in the retina, potentially accelerating AMD. Reduced blinking when focused on screens (people blink 66% less when using screens) causes dry eye. Poor ergonomics—screen too close, too low, or at an awkward angle—creates neck strain that impairs blood flow to the eyes and contributes to eye strain.
Additionally, extended near-work can worsen myopia (nearsightedness). If you’re predisposed to myopia, the more time you spend in near-vision work, the more your myopia progresses. Children are particularly affected, but adults can also experience myopia progression.
Cumulative UV exposure from sun exposure across your 35–45 years accelerates cataracts and contributes to macular changes. UV protection that wasn’t prioritized in earlier decades now becomes critical.
Warning Signs Your Eyes Need Attention
- Difficulty focusing on near objects: text blurs when you hold it close, or you can’t read small print without squinting.
- Eye strain or fatigue after screen work, typically worse by late afternoon.
- Blurred or hazy vision that seems to come and go.
- Glare sensitivity, especially during night driving. Oncoming headlights, streetlights, or reflections bother you more than they used to.
- Dry, gritty, or uncomfortable eyes, especially after screen use or in air-conditioned environments.
- Floaters (small spots or lines that float in your vision), though occasional floaters are often benign.
- Halos around lights, especially at night.
- Reduced peripheral vision or dark spots appearing in your visual field.
- Difficulty with night driving or seeing clearly in low light.
- Frequent changes in your glasses or contacts prescription, suggesting rapid eye changes.
What Protects and Preserves Eye Health: Evidence-Based Interventions
The most important intervention is UV protection. UV rays damage the lens and retina, accelerating cataracts and contributing to macular degeneration. Wearing sunglasses with 100% UVA and UVB protection whenever you’re outdoors significantly reduces this risk. Even on cloudy days, UV rays penetrate clouds. Wearing protective sunglasses every time you go outside, even briefly, is non-negotiable. A wide-brimmed hat adds additional protection.
Screen management is crucial. The 20-20-20 rule is effective: every 20 minutes of screen work, look at something 20 feet away for 20 seconds. This relaxes your focusing muscles. Additionally, reduce overall screen time where possible. Use your computer at arm’s length (about 20 inches away), with the screen slightly below eye level so you’re looking slightly downward (this reduces eye strain). Adjust brightness to match your environment. Use blue-light filtering glasses or software that reduces blue light from screens. Blink consciously when using screens; most people forget to blink while focused on screens.
Nutrition specifically supports eye health. Lutein and zeaxanthin, carotenoids found in leafy greens, accumulate in the macula and protect against macular degeneration. Vitamin C and vitamin E are antioxidants that protect against oxidative stress. Zinc is essential for retinal function. Omega-3 fatty acids support retinal health. A Mediterranean-style diet (discussed in Articles 1 and 2) with emphasis on leafy greens, fatty fish, nuts, and olive oil supports eye health. Additionally, supplementing with a lutein-containing eye health supplement can help if dietary intake is insufficient.
Anti-inflammatory lifestyle factors support eye health. Chronic inflammation accelerates all age-related eye diseases. Sleep, exercise, stress management, and anti-inflammatory diet all protect your eyes indirectly by reducing systemic inflammation.
Regular eye exams are important. Annual or biennial eye exams (more frequent as you age) can identify early signs of macular degeneration, glaucoma, cataracts, or other conditions. Early detection allows early intervention, which can slow or prevent vision loss.
If you have presbyopia or refractive errors, correct them. Wearing the right prescription reduces eye strain and protects eye muscles from overwork.

The Inflammation-Eye Connection You Might Not Know About
Here’s what doesn’t get enough emphasis: chronic inflammation is a primary driver of age-related eye diseases. Systemic inflammation accelerates macular degeneration, contributes to glaucoma progression, and worsens dry eye. This means that the anti-inflammatory lifestyle factors discussed throughout these articles—Mediterranean-style diet, regular exercise, adequate sleep, stress management—directly protect your eyes.
Someone eating a processed-food diet high in seed oils and refined carbohydrates, sleeping poorly, sedentary, and stressed will have more inflammation system-wide, including in their eyes. Their eyes will age faster. Someone eating a Mediterranean-style diet, exercising regularly, sleeping well, and managing stress will have less inflammation, and their eyes will age more slowly. The lifestyle factors that protect your overall health protect your eyes specifically. Your eyes are not separate from your body; they’re part of your integrated biological system.
